CC -!- FUNCTION: DNA-dependent ATPase and 3'-5' DNA helicase that may be
CC involved in repair of stalled replication forks. {ECO:0000255|HAMAP-
CC Rule:MF_00442}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=ATP + H2O = ADP + H(+) + phosphate; Xref=Rhea:RHEA:13065,
CC 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:30616,
CC ChEBI:CHEBI:43474, ChEBI:CHEBI:456216; EC=3.6.4.12;
CC Evidence={ECO:0000255|HAMAP-Rule:MF_00442};
CC -!- SUBUNIT: Monomer. {ECO:0000255|HAMAP-Rule:MF_00442}.
CC -!- SIMILARITY: Belongs to the helicase family. Hel308 subfamily.
CC {ECO:0000255|HAMAP-Rule:MF_00442}.
